Its a special exercise in which players skate hard until the coach believes they have made their point. Some players believe that the term refers to the old days, when trainers would place plastic or paper bags rink side because they knew some players would need a place to heave in exhaustion after the gruelling workout. It went mainstream thanks in large part to a memorable scene in the 2004 movie Miracle in which Brooks skates his Team USA players into the ice following a disappointing showing in an exhibition game in Norway. Death and legacy On the afternoon of August 11, 2003, six days after his 66th birthday, Brooks died in a single-car accident on Interstate 35 near Forest Lake, Minnesota.
